This is the QMK firmware repository for the CK60i PCB. This is a universal 60% tray mount PCB sold by CandyKeys and designed by Gondolindrim.
The CK60i supports:
The CK60i is available for purchase through Candy Keys' store.
After setting up your build environment, you can compile the CK60i default keymap by using:
make ck60i:default
See the build environment setup and the make instructions for more information. Brand new to QMK? Start with our Complete Newbs Guide.
